高温胁迫对苹果叶片膜脂过氧化及抗坏血酸的影响

摘    要:为探索AsA代谢对高温胁迫的响应,研究了高温胁迫不同时间对苹果叶片AsA含量、氧化还原状态的影响.结果表明:苹果叶片MDA和H2O2含量随高温处理时间的延长而增加;总抗坏血酸、AsA含量在高温处理2 h时达最大,之后开始下降;AsA/DHA比值均随高温处理时间的延长而下降.

Effects of High Temperature Stress on Lipid Peroxidation and Ascorbic Acid Content in Apple Leaves

Abstract:The AsA content and its redox state of apple leaves under different high temperature stress were studied to know response of AsA metabolism to high temperature stress.The results showed that the MDA and H2O2 content in apple leaves increased with the increase of high temperature treatment time,the total ascorbic acid and AsA content reached the highest under high temperature treatment for 2 h,and the AsA/DHA ratio decreased with the increase of high temperature treatment time.
